Summary
The infinite tensor product is generalized to a tensor product of certain Hilbert spaces over a topological index set. The criterion for positivity of characteristic functionals of generalized random processes is used to construct two distinct types of continuous tensor products. Representations of the canonical commutation relations (CCR) are constructed in one of these. The other is seen to be useful in the construction of certain quantum fields.
